The System Engineer plays a crucial role in the Amazon Robotics deployment team. They oversee the installation, troubleshooting, integration, and commissioning of Amazon Robotics equipment in new and existing fulfillment centers (FCs). This field engineering based position demands strong technical skills for deploying robotic equipment, including working with mechanical systems, electrical, configuring networking, and coordinating software systems. While training is provided on the specific systems that the engineers will be working on, a candidate should have foundational knowledge of robotics, networked mechanical systems, and electrical systems. System engineers will work with a team of 1-5 engineers and collaborate with an on-site project manager to provide technical oversight on the installation of both third party and Amazon designed robotics equipment. These deployments require extensive collaboration with varies stakeholders, including third-party installers, contracted engineers, construction, hardware, software, IT, and other partner teams. Strong communication skills are essential for interacting with both internal and external partners and customers.
